Initial reports say the category three storm caused no serious damage.
It passed as forecast to the south of the Isle of Pines which was the only part of the territory on full alert.
The system brought gales of up to 130 km an hour as well as heavy rain.
Hilary Roots, who lives on the Isle of Pines, said Cyclone Gita was frightening as it passed through Friday night.
She said there was less rain than forecast but there were very strong wind gusts.
Ms Roots said the eye passed a hundred kilometres to south of the Isle.
